Protectionism
A call for tariffs and favourable treatments to protect domestic firms from foreign competition.
Foreign Competition
The presence of competitors from other countries in a domestic market, highlighting the global nature of the market and challenges for local firms.
Tariffs
Taxes imposed on imported or, less commonly, exported goods, used by governments to regulate trade, protect domestic industries, or generate revenue.
Importing Products
The business activity of bringing goods or services into one country from another to sell them.
